The first installment in the now famous The Executioner series, its creator, Don Pendleton, created the greatest literary action hero, who has now been featured in over 600 novels. Pendleton himself wrote 37 of the first 38 books published by Pinnacle before licensing the rights to Gold Eagle, who then started to use a series of ghost writers to continue the series as MACK BOLAN. Pendleton wrote only 2 of these new episodes before his death in 1995. This first episode tells the background story of the Executioner: released from Vietnam on compassionate leave after the death of his father, Mack goes after the mafia loan sharks who cause his father's demise. Thus starts the greatest and longest running action series ever as Bolan attempts to eradicate the Mafia across America.
